WebMay 1, 2024 · Cumin has traditionally been used for its anti-inflammatory, diuretic, carminative, and antispasmodic effects. It has also been used as an aid for treating dyspepsia, jaundice, diarrhea, flatulence, and indigestion. In Iran, historical uses include for the treatment of toothaches and epilepsy.
